With high range of up to 70 mi (ca. 113 km) and fully adjustable seat for driver, it offers comfortable ride for you and one other person. On to of that it can easily carrying max weight of 300 kg / 47st while ascending a road slope of 30% (17°).
What is FROST electric mobility vehicle equipped with?
All the highest quality technologies come in various form and shapes. FROST outshines all other similar fully encased electric mobility vehicles by a far margin. Within the complex heart of the machine, similar to moped scooter, the happy vehicle owners can find:
- MP3/MP4 player,
- Powerful 2000W motor with voltage of 72V,
- Lead-acid battery with the size of 72V 60Ah,
- Hydraulic brakes & automatic magnetic brake,
- Comprehensive lights system which include: street lighting, LED lamps, intuitive operation,
- Alarm and remote control,
- Full suspension,
- Hand brake,
- Reverse camera making it easier to park,
- Powerful charger which can easily fill up the better in just 3 hours,
- Electric side window controls.
Just CBT training & Provisional Licence
This electric mobility vehicle falls under the category of mopeds. It means that you don’t need to have full driving licence and can drive it as long as you have finished at least 16 years. Be advised, in the UK you should go through Compulsory basic training (CBT) and have AM category licence (provisional one).
As any vehicle which can travel on roads, even with speed of 27 mph (ca. 43 km/h), it requires DVLA registration.
